- Lead and manage land development projects from conception to completion, including site planning, design, permitting, and construction administration.
- Collaborate with clients, architects, planners, regulatory agencies, and internal team members to develop project scopes, budgets, and schedules.
- Conduct site feasibility studies, including land use analysis, zoning reviews, and environmental assessments.
- Prepare and review engineering design calculations, plans, and specifications for site grading, utilities, stormwater management, and erosion control.
- Obtain necessary permits and approvals from regulatory agencies, ensuring compliance with local, state, and federal regulations.
- Coordinate and oversee the work of design consultants, contractors, and subcontractors throughout the project lifecycle.
- Manage project budgets, timelines, and resources to ensure projects are delivered within scope and budget constraints.
- Conduct regular site visits and inspections to monitor construction progress, quality, and compliance with design specifications.
- Proactively identify and mitigate project risks and issues to ensure successful project delivery.
- Communicate project status, updates, and issues to clients, stakeholders, and senior management.
- Lead business development efforts by maintaining and growing client relationships in the private sector.
- Develop pursuit strategies for new project opportunities, including proposals, interviews, and client negotiations.
- Drive projects involving platting, subdivision design, and entitlement processes for commercial, multifamily, and master‑planned communities.
- Minimum 15 years of experience specifically in private‑sector land development, including at least 5 years leading projects involving platting, commercial site development, and multifamily or mixed‑use work. Proven track record of developing new business and negotiating profitable project awards in the Puget Sound region is required.
- Registered Engineer in the State of Washington.
